Revert "MessageCache invalidation improvements" (temporary)
authorAndrew Green <andrew.green.df@gmail.com>
Tue, 29 Nov 2016 01:06:00 +0000 (19:06 -0600)
committerAndrew Green <andrew.green.df@gmail.com>
Tue, 29 Nov 2016 01:31:42 +0000 (19:31 -0600)
commit3a4105ba01fc92f2d41e0faee316d02e29f82fe5
tree2b203d51e6d9e37f189d00c7cbc5ca21e156ff38
parenta3cb3cd362f70c6bc8e3cfee47ad5c6fa159c361
Revert "MessageCache invalidation improvements" (temporary)

This reverts commit 9339a08b72c918d7743a9cb286161adb9399a77b
(Change-Id: Idc337a787171949c4f70186b13d7b65304c9b57f).

This is a temporary revert to prevent the change's inclusion in
wmf/1.29.0-wmf.4. That branch is scheduled to be deployed to WMF wikis
during the first week of the WMF's 2016 year-end fundraiser. Since
CentralNotice relies on MessageCache to fetch fundraising banners,
it is preferable not to deploy changes of any significant complexity in
that system at this time.

The original change should be re-applied at a later date. Sincere
apologies to the change's authors! :)

Change-Id: I8330838bbe03ce6ed38fa2e755b44519211d9d43
includes/cache/MessageCache.php
includes/page/WikiPage.php